We are seeking a Robotics Engineer to join our team on a contract basis. The ideal candidate will have expertise in developing autonomous systems for un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) and contribute to our cutting-edge drone squad technology.

Who we are

Mutable Tactics is a pioneering technology company specializing in advanced autonomy for squad robotic systems. We’re blending cutting-edge computer vision, ML, multi-agent AI and probabilistic inference techniques into autonomous UxV solutions for complex, mission-critical operations. Our team is dedicated to pushing the boundaries of robotics and AI, with a strong focus on safety and ethical considerations in autonomous systems. Based in Cambridge we’re building a diverse team of talented individuals who share our passion for innovation and pushing the boundaries of what's possible in autonomous systems. We offer a dynamic and collaborative work environment where creativity and problem-solving are highly valued.

About the Role

At MT we are developing AI capabilities to orchestrate UAVs together, even if heterogeneous (with different capabilities) or built by different OEMs to solve complex missions such as the ability to search enemy objectives, track and engage, autonomously. You will have the unique opportunity to shape AI capabilities in one of the most challenging environments: fast changing, resource constrained, secure, and with high generalization capabilities.

Core Technical Skills

Robotics Frameworks: ROS/ROS2, Nav2, MoveIt, Ardupilot, PX4, OMPL, PCL, Zenoh
Embedded Systems: PX4 Firmware, UART, SPI, I2C, CAN, MAVLink
Edge: Jetson, Qualcomm (QRB5), AIMET, TensorRT, Quantization (int4,int8), Quantization Aware Training, Pruning, Distillation.
Simulation: Gazebo, IsaacSim, UnReal Engine(AirSim), Foxglove Studio, RViz2.
Programming & Tools: C++, Python, Git, Docker, CI/CD, Linux, Docker/Podman
ML specific skills
Stochastic processes: behavior trees, FSMs, MDPs
Learning: RL, Bayesian networks (and BBP)
Scripting languages: PDDL, RDDL
